The Midnight Sun Gun Dog Association (MSGDA) is a dog training club dedicated to sportsmen and women, their families and their hunting companions (primarily retrievers).  MSGDA is a local non-profit organization that is a member of the North American Hunting Retriever Association (NAHRA).

Belonging to MSGDA is a great way to meet people who love hunting dogs and love to hunt; to share training techniques and tips with other members while enjoying the great Alaska outdoors; and to spend time with your favorite hunting companion.  Whether you are new to retriever training or an old hand at it, MSGDA has something to offer to everyone.

Many sportsmen and women have never had the opportunity to observe good hunting dogs work, and therefore do not know the potential of their own hunting dogs.  Alaskan hunters need a structure which allows them to learn training techniques and methods to accurately evaluate their dogs.  They also need a system of informal events and formal tests that demonstrate and record their dog's working accomplishments.

MSGDA provides these opportunities by regularly sponsoring picnic events, hunt tests and educational events to promote field testing of hunting dogs in simulated hunting situations and to educate the public in the use of hunting dogs as conservation animals.

Each year the MSGDA hosts two 2-day NAHRA licensed field tests. There are four levels of tests for you and your retriever:

  • Beginner Level is designed for puppies or new retrievers and consists of short retrieves for birds;
  • Started Level consists of single retrieves (up to 75 yards in distance);
  • Intermdiate Level requires double retrieves (up to 100 yards in distance); and
  • Senior Level dogs are asked complete triple retrievers (up to 100 yards in distance).
